NEWS - HISTORY WORKSHOPS IMPORTANT FOR 3RD YEAR STUDENTS Read carefully

Workshops with mandatory frequency are divided into two sections: the first one (12 hours), common to everyone, about bibliographic research and sources; the second one (18 hours) provides 4 specific chronological paths.

Three turns are planned for the first 12 hours, which will take place at San Giovanni in Monte (Aula Morandi).
The first one starts on October 10, 2018 and ends on October 31, 2018. The other ones will take place on November 2018 and February 2019. 

Specific paths will begin in November: you can download schedules from the attached file, but you can find them also on the website of professors who are responsible of the different chronological areas (professors Cristofori, Roversi Monaco, Guerrini, Casalena), together with the specific programs.

Interested students are kindly requested to register by writing an email to francesca.roversi@unibo.it, by specifying the turn they wish to attend.

Given the capacity of the Aula Morandi (25 seats), in case of higher requests for a single turn, the order of precedence in the inscription will be followed.

To obtain the final suitability, the frequency of at least 25 hours out of 30 is mandatory; absences must be justified, and the attendance register is expected.
